What Is Cinnamyl Nitrile?
Cinnamyl nitrile is an aroma ingredient first introduced to the fragrance industry in the late 1960s when chemists were exploring new ways to add warmth to spicy accords. It is produced by reacting cinnamyl alcohol with a nitrile source under controlled conditions, creating a stable molecule that does not occur in nature in any meaningful quantity. For that reason it is classified as a fully synthetic material.
At room temperature the substance presents as a clear mobile liquid that can appear nearly colorless or take on a faint yellow tint. Because of its relatively high density and refractive index it feels slightly heavier than many common perfume solvents, yet it still pours easily. In cool storage the liquid may thicken or form soft crystals, a normal characteristic that disappears once the material is gently warmed.
Perfumers reach for cinnamyl nitrile across a wide range of product types, from fine fragrance to everyday cleaners. It is valued for its reliability and stability, which allow it to survive harsh manufacturing steps such as high-temperature soap making. Although demand is steady the raw material is generally considered affordable thanks to efficient large-scale production, so it finds its way into mass market formulations as well as premium blends.
Availability through multiple global suppliers makes it an easy item to stock in a studio or factory, and its long shelf life means there is little risk of spoilage when stored correctly.
What Does Cinnamyl Nitrile Smell Like?
Most perfumers file cinnamyl nitrile under the spicy family. On a smelling strip the first impression is a warm almost cinnamon-like spice laced with a soft floral nuance that keeps it from feeling too dry. There is an oily richness running through the note, giving it a rounded mouth-coating quality rather than a sharp bite. As the minutes pass the floral facet grows clearer while the initial heat mellows, leaving a gentle woody warmth in the background.
In the classic pyramid of top, middle and base notes cinnamyl nitrile performs mainly in the heart where its richness can knit brighter notes to deeper resins. It reveals itself after the more volatile materials lift off yet it still hangs on long enough to influence the drydown, so some perfumers see it as straddling middle and lower registers.
Projection sits in the medium range. It will not dominate a blend unless overdosed but it provides a steady aura that radiates at arm’s length in the early stages. Longevity is good: traces of its warm spicy tone can linger on skin or textiles for eight to twelve hours depending on the overall formula.
How & Where To Use Cinnamyl Nitrile
This is one of those materials that feels friendly at the bench. It pours without fuss, does not stain glassware and rarely surprises you with off notes when diluted.
Perfumers pull it in when they need a warm floral spice that sits between true cinnamon and clove but without the dry fiery edge those molecules can bring. It rounds out carnation, ylang or rose hearts, adds texture to gourmand accords and lends a soft glow to woody ambers. When a formula looks skeletal in the mid notes a touch of cinnamyl nitrile often fills the gap and links citrus sparkle to deeper resins.
A typical usage sits anywhere from a trace to about 2 % of the concentrate, peaking near 5 % in soap where higher levels are needed to survive the cure. At 0.1 % it contributes a subtle spicy lift hardly noticed on its own, while at 1 % the floral warmth becomes clear and the oily richness starts to coat the blend. Push it above 3 % and the note can dominate, leaving a heavy balsamic trail that may muddy light colognes or aquatics.
It shines in solid cleansers, candles and fabric care because the molecule resists acid and base attack. It is less successful in ultra fresh marine or green compositions where its weight can feel out of place. If the material has clouded in cool storage simply warm the sealed bottle in a water bath around 30 °C then shake to restore full clarity, no other prep work required.
Safely Information
Working with cinnamyl nitrile is straightforward yet certain precautions must always be observed when handling any aroma chemical.
- Always dilute before evaluation: prepare a 10 % solution in ethanol or dipropylene glycol and smell on a blotter rather than straight from the bottle
- Ventilation: use it in a fume hood or well aired space to keep vapor build up low and reduce inhalation risk
- Personal protection: wear nitrile gloves and safety glasses to prevent accidental skin or eye contact
- Health considerations: some people may develop irritation or allergic reactions so avoid prolonged skin exposure, and consult a healthcare professional if pregnant or breastfeeding
- Exposure limits: brief work with low concentrations is considered safe but repeated handling of neat material or high strength solutions can cause sensitisation
Always consult the most recent safety data sheet from your supplier and review it periodically for updates, and follow current IFRA guidelines on maximum use levels to ensure consumer safety.
Storage And Disposal
When kept under ideal conditions cinnamyl nitrile remains in spec for roughly three to five years, sometimes longer if the bottle is opened infrequently. Oxidation is slow but still noticeable over time so anything approaching the five year mark should be checked against a fresh standard before use in fine work.
The simplest way to preserve quality is to store the neat material in a cool dark cabinet away from direct sunlight and strong heat sources. Refrigeration is not essential yet a stable temperature around 4 °C can add months of extra shelf life, especially for partial bottles.
Use tight fitting polycone caps on both stock and dilution bottles. These liners form a better vapor seal than rubber bulbs or glass droppers which can let air creep in and also drip solvent onto labels. Avoid dropper tops altogether for long term storage.
Try to keep containers as full as practical. Topping up with inert gas or transferring to a smaller bottle once the fill level drops below half will limit headspace oxygen and slow oxidation.
Label every container clearly with the ingredient name, concentration, date of preparation and key safety phrases so there is no confusion during a busy blending session. Good labeling also helps anyone else in the workspace understand hazards at a glance.
For disposal small laboratory quantities can be mixed with absorbent material such as sand or vermiculite and sent to a licensed chemical waste handler. Do not pour it down the drain; the molecule is not readily biodegradable and may persist in aquatic systems. Empty bottles should be triple rinsed with solvent, the rinse collected for waste, then recycled or discarded according to local regulations.
Summary
Cinnamyl nitrile is a fully synthetic spicy floral note that adds warm cinnamon like depth without the harsh bite of true cinnamon oil. It smells cozy, slightly oily and softly floral making it a versatile bridge between bright top notes and heavy bases.
In perfumery it slips happily into carnation or rose hearts, sweet gourmands, woody ambers and even functional products like soap and detergent thanks to its solid stability and moderate price. Most creators start with fractions of a percent then push higher in rugged bases where a lasting spicy glow is desired.
It pours easily, survives high pH and heat, costs less than many naturals and stays fresh for years when stored with care so it has earned a steady place on many lab benches. Just remember to guard against slow oxidation, respect recommended skin limits and your formulas will benefit from a friendly material that can tie accords together and add inviting warmth with very little fuss.
